Why Your Business Needs a Loyalty App

A loyalty card app is no longer a nice-to-have—it is essential for businesses competing for customer attention. According to Queue-it research, the global loyalty management market reached $18.2 billion in 2026, with 90% of loyalty program owners reporting positive ROI averaging 4.8x their investment.

The shift from paper punch cards to mobile apps is accelerating. In 2026, 80% of customers are willing to download a brand's app for loyalty benefits, and truly loyal members use these apps weekly or daily.

Types of Loyalty Programs

Different businesses benefit from different loyalty program structures. The key is matching the program type to your customer behavior and business model.

Punch Card (Stamp-Based)

Best for: Cafes, bakeries, quick-service restaurants

Customers earn a stamp per visit or purchase. After X stamps, they receive a free item or discount.

Advantages

  • Simple to understand
  • Clear goal for customers
  • Low friction

Considerations

  • Limited engagement options
  • No spend incentive

Example

Buy 10 coffees, get 1 free

Points-Based System

Best for: Retail stores, restaurants, e-commerce

Customers earn points per dollar spent. Points can be redeemed for rewards, discounts, or exclusive items.

Advantages

  • Encourages higher spending
  • Flexible redemption
  • Scalable

Considerations

  • Requires more explanation
  • Points devaluation risk

Example

Earn 1 point per $1 spent, redeem 100 points for $10 off

Tiered (VIP) Programs

Best for: Salons, fitness centers, premium brands

Customers unlock higher tiers through spending or visits. Each tier offers better perks.

Advantages

  • Creates aspirational goals
  • Rewards best customers
  • High engagement

Considerations

  • More complex to manage
  • May alienate casual customers

Example

Silver → Gold → Platinum with increasing benefits

Subscription/Membership

Best for: Gyms, clubs, exclusive services

Customers pay a fee for exclusive access, discounts, or perks. Creates predictable revenue.

Advantages

  • Guaranteed revenue
  • Strong commitment
  • Premium positioning

Considerations

  • Barrier to entry
  • Requires clear value proposition

Example

VIP Club: $9.99/month for 20% off all purchases

Best Practices for Loyalty Program Success

According to Yotpo's analysis of successful loyalty programs, these practices separate thriving programs from those that fail to engage customers.

Do This

  • Make enrollment instant and frictionless
  • Show progress clearly (e.g., 3/10 stamps)
  • Reward quickly—first benefit within 2-3 visits
  • Send personalized push notifications
  • Celebrate milestones with surprise rewards
  • Offer exclusive member-only experiences
  • Integrate referral bonuses for advocacy
  • Track and share program ROI with your team

Avoid This

  • Complicated rules that confuse customers
  • Rewards that feel impossible to reach
  • Generic, impersonal communications
  • Expiring points without clear notice
  • No mobile app (only web or paper)
  • Ignoring inactive members
  • One-size-fits-all reward options
  • Not measuring program performance
